带小数点的数怎么转化为二进制
计算器怎么求小数的二进制?
计算器怎么求小数的二进制?
打开计算器,然后点查看,点科学型,如果要十进制转为二进制的话,先在十进制前选定,然后输入要计算的数据,然后再点二进制,就好了,十六进制换八进制也是这样的!
二进制转8进制小数部分怎么算?
因为2的3次方等于8,因此2进制转换为8进制的方法是:
整数部分从低位到高位按3位一组进行分组,最后一组不足3位前面补0;小数部分从高位到低位进行分组,最后一组不足3位后面补0。然后将每组的3位2进制转换为1位的8进制即可。
10进制小数转2进制公式?
将十进制小数转化为二进制小数的方法
十进制小数→二进制小数:(1)把十进制小数乘以2,得到积,把积的整数部分提出;(2)再用所得积的小数部分乘以2,得到积,把积的整数部分提出;(3)重复步骤2;(4)乘以2过程中提出的各个整数部分组成转换后的二进制小数。权的确定规则:最先提出的整数是二进制小数的最高位。
看个例子就明白le :
37.8125(十进制)的运算分为整数部分和小数部分:
整数部分的结果是100101。
小数部分:0.8125*21.6250,将整数部分1提出;0.6250*21.2500,将整数部分1提出;0.2500*20.5000,整数部分为0;0.5000*21.0000,整数部分为1;所以小数部分的结果是0.1101。
所以最后的结果是100101.1101。
八进制转二进制小数怎么算?
将8进制转化为二进制,可采用起一分三法,即将一位八进制数分解成三位二进制数,三位二进制数按权相加去凑这位八进制数,小数位与整数位的转换方法相同,小数点位置不变。
例如:将八进制数67.54转换为二进制数
按上述方法将八进制数67.54转换为二进制数为:
110111.101100,即110111.1011
详细的转化过程如下:
首先,将八进制按照从左到右,每位展开为三位,小数点位置不变;然后,按每位展开为2^2,2^1,2^0…(即4、2、1)三位去做凑数,即a×2^2 b×2^1 c×2^0该位上的8进制数(a1或者a0,b1或者b0,c1或者c0),将abc排列就是该位的二进制数接着,将每位上转换成二进制数按顺序排列最后,就得到了八进制转换成二进制的数字。
比如:8进制数4转化为二进制数为100,8进制数5转化为二进制数为101,8进制数7转化为二进制数为111,8进制数6转化为二进制数为110,然后将6、7、5、4
这几个8进制数位上的数所对应的二进制数按序排列,在相应的位置加上小数点,所得到的二进制数就是67.54这个8进制数转化成二进制数所对应的结果。